Financial Performance - The company's revenue for Q3 2021 was CNY 410,316,806.46, representing a 35.64% increase year-over-year, while the year-to-date revenue reached CNY 1,040,262,144.08, up 33.60% compared to the same period last year[3]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for Q3 2021 was CNY 17,060,332.44, a decrease of 32.88% year-over-year, and the year-to-date net profit was CNY 19,544,111.80, down 58.94% compared to the previous year[3]. - The company’s basic earnings per share for Q3 2021 were CNY 0.0928, down 33.33% year-over-year[3]. - Total operating revenue for Q3 2021 reached ¥1,040,262,144.08, an increase of 33.5% compared to ¥778,653,474.46 in the same period last year[24]. - Net profit for Q3 2021 was ¥22,726,130.49, a decrease of 57.5% from ¥53,393,344.24 in Q3 2020[25]. - Earnings per share (EPS) for Q3 2021 was ¥0.1063, down from ¥0.2607 in the previous year[26]. - The company reported a decrease in comprehensive income to ¥24,022,115.92 in Q3 2021 from ¥50,870,781.10 in the previous year, a decline of 52.8%[25]. Cash Flow and Operating Activities - The company's cash flow from operating activities showed a net outflow of CNY 52,974,782.67 year-to-date, marking a significant decline of 852.84%[3]. - Total cash inflow from operating activities was 1,184,839,219.44 CNY, compared to 813,670,564.17 CNY in the previous period, representing an increase of approximately 45.5%[27]. - Cash outflow from operating activities totaled 1,237,814,002.11 CNY, up from 806,633,934.43 CNY, indicating a rise of about 53.4%[27]. - Cash received from other operating activities surged by 259.67% to ¥90,230,969.32, attributed to increased payments from paper and other material trade[10]. - Cash received from sales of goods and services was 1,011,082,856.10 CNY, an increase from 729,388,185.95 CNY, reflecting a growth of approximately 38.7%[27]. - Cash paid for purchasing goods and services increased by 53.54% to ¥772,033,896.98, mainly due to higher procurement of raw materials and finished products[10]. - Cash paid to employees rose by 44.62% to ¥234,032,943.33, reflecting higher wages and increased labor insurance and benefits costs[10]. - Cash paid for other operating activities increased by 67.68% to ¥214,622,238.31, driven by higher payments in paper and material trade[10]. Assets and Liabilities - Total assets as of September 30, 2021, were CNY 1,510,268,407.07, reflecting a 7.97% increase from the end of the previous year[3]. - Current assets decreased to CNY 853,081,595.58 from CNY 897,325,956.85, indicating a decline of about 5%[21]. - The total liabilities increased to CNY 853,081,595.58, compared to the previous period, indicating a rise in financial obligations[21]. - The company reported a significant increase in fixed assets, which rose to CNY 387,189,295.10 from CNY 325,398,289.06, an increase of approximately 19%[21]. - The company's short-term borrowings rose by 31.46% to CNY 315,712,987.15, attributed to increased bank loans[8]. - The total liabilities increased to ¥778,113,234.34 in Q3 2021 from ¥667,502,847.67 in Q3 2020, reflecting a growth of 16.6%[24]. Operating Costs and Expenses - The company reported a 41.84% increase in operating costs, totaling CNY 782,522,698.03, due to rising raw material prices and increased shipping costs for cross-border e-commerce[9]. - Sales expenses increased by 65.18% year-over-year to CNY 63,264,649.82, driven by higher advertising and platform service fees related to cross-border e-commerce[9]. - Total operating costs for Q3 2021 were ¥1,018,699,101.62, up 40.4% from ¥725,936,826.07 year-over-year[24]. - Research and development expenses for Q3 2021 amounted to ¥44,027,907.22, an increase of 20% compared to ¥36,714,503.73 in Q3 2020[24]. - The financial expenses for Q3 2021 were ¥15,754,490.88, which is a significant increase from ¥7,793,660.87 in Q3 2020[24].
